I am seeking an experienced IT & Programming professional tofor my private game server project. The server is designed for a game with closed official servers and communicates with the client using EA's proprietary Blaze protocol (binary tdf-encoded tcp) and http for ultimate team functionalities. The server is implemented in Python and runs on an Ubuntu operating system, with the code managed in a private Git repository. Current Progress: Blaze login/authentication handshake, persona creation, and session redirector are fully functional. The complete Ultimate Team HTTP layer, including club management, squads, transfer market, SBCs, and drafts, is working, allowing the client to boot and play offline modes. Challenges Requiring Expertise: 1. Online Matchmaking via Blaze GameManager: I am currently facing difficulties in implementing online matchmaking. While I can create and join games and push notifications, I need assistance in correctly identifying the required notification IDs, managing GameState transitions, and ensuring the precise packet ordering that the FIFA 17 client expects. Incorrect implementation leads to the client being stuck on "searching" or returning to the main menu without an error. 2. Peer Connectivity: The client reports an external ip of 0 (exip=0), preventing direct p2p connections. I have developed a basic UDP relay and a relayed-topology solution, drawing inspiration from other open-source Blaze server implementations. I require an expert to review this solution, identify any errors, and provide guidance based on a deep understanding of Blaze's connection and Quality of Service (QoS) model. I am looking for a professional who can provide insights, debug complex protocol interactions, and guide me through these advanced networking and protocol-specific challenges. Experience with game server development, network protocols, and Python is essential.
